Bitcoin ATMs are booming. According to one industry data platform, there are now more than 38,300 ATMs globally, up from a mere 150 a decade ago. With Bitcoin hitting a new all-time high this year, the ETF boom, and positive regulations, the numbers are projected to surge even higher this year.

According to Coin ATM Radar, there are 38,308 Bitcoin ATMs globally, a number that has been on an uptrend since June last year. The all-time high stands at 39,541 in December 2022, before a slight dip to just over 32,000 in June last year.

The US remains the runaway leader with 31,833 ATMs, more than ten times those of second-placed Canada, which has just over 3,000 ATMs. Australia’s 1,109 ATMs are the third-highest. The land down under is almost catching up with the entire European region, which has 1,591 ATMS collectively.

Spain, Poland, and El Salvador are the only other countries with over 200 ATMs.

Unsurprisingly, Bitcoin dominates the ATMs. Bitcoin Cash is a distant second, just ahead of Ethereum. Other older coins like Litecoin, Dash, Zcash, and Monero have a small presence despite slipping down the charts and being eclipsed by newer and shinier projects like Solana and BNB.

The Future of Bitcoin ATMs

The growth in the number of Bitcoin ATMs speaks to the rising need for a more private and secure access point to crypto. While online platforms are easily accessible and safe, some in the crypto space still prefer the guaranteed privacy that comes with ATMs. These machines accept cash payments and deliver the crypto directly to one’s wallet address.

However, they come with their risks. This lack of KYC and easy access has made them prime targets for criminals. In several cases of ransom demands involving crypto, victims are directed to make crypto payments via ATMs, making these machines an area of increasing focus for regulators.
